Rosie’s Visit To The Vet (Day 7) 23rd Feb 2017, by AnimalCare
We just returned from the vet’s. First of all, many, many thanks to dear Peggy Tiong for taking Rosie and me all the way to PJ to the vet’s.
Second, there’s so much information to share – I hope I can remember all of them!
What I learnt:
The most important thing for Rosie right now, to help her liver heal is good and quality nutrition and for cats, this translates to good, quality and high protein. The vet suggests egg (yolk and white, cooked) and even fish. And whi...

Rosie’s News – A Setback (Day 6, Evening) 22nd Feb 2017, by AnimalCare
We brought Rosie for a check-up and the intended subcut fluids this evening.
Complaining all the way….
When the vet palpated her liver, it felt more enlarged than Monday (but not as big as Friday). However, this is still a setback. We were really hoping it would be smaller than Monday. But it is not.
We don’t know why. Could it be due to her going out and possibly eating something outside. Or, as the vet discussed at length, it could also be something that I can fed her. Maybe pre...

Willow, The Injured Cat From Henderson Road 22nd Feb 2017, by SPCA Singapore
UPDATES ON WILLOW, THE INJURED CAT FROM HENDERSON ROAD
On Saturday, 18 February, we received a call from a concerned member of the public, informing us of a badly injured cat at Henderson Road.
SPCA’s Animal Rescue Officer, Ish, attended to the call and found a tabby grey, female, local cat with its intestines dangling out. The cat was rushed to a clinic for emergency surgery and we are glad to report that the cat is doing well and is currently recovering with us.
